搭建数据中台的价值与所需技术

本文先梳理了何以必要数据中台,以及数据中台建立须要用到什么本领,什么平台。

码人网mrw.so缩短网址文章图片

01

在谈过交易中台和数据中台的辨别后,即日再谈下数据中台。开始咱们瞅下网上闭于于数据中台的一个定义和说法,即:

数据中台是指经过数据本领,闭于海量数据进行采集、估计、保存、加工,共时普遍尺度和口径。数据中台把数据普遍之后,会产生尺度数据,再进行保存,产生大数据财产层,从而为客户供给高效效劳。这些效劳跟企业的交易有较强通联性,是这个企业独占且能复用的。

假如径自瞅这个定义,那么数据中台很容易被领会为企业里面的BI体系兴办,包括了ODS库和数据仓库,共时救济OLTP和OLAP本领。也不妨说是建立企业的大数据平台。

此刻天本人想谈下闭于数据中台这个观念的一些领会:

开始咱们要瞅到数据中台是所有企业中台战术的一局部,是协共企业微效劳架构转型和交易中台本领建立不可缺乏的局部。

假如不所有中台战术,那么便不存留数据中台,你径自去兴办大数据平台大概BI平台便不妨了。

数据中台不是一个简单的数据本领平台,而是一个共享数据本领供给平台。闭于于数据的采集,荡涤,保存和加工最后都是为了盛开数据效劳本领。

假如说交易中台更多的是交易本领的开拓,那么数据中台即是会合后的数据效劳本领的盛开。

何以要盛开数据效劳本领?

这个绝闭于不是大概的给上层干BI来领会用的,而是这种数据效劳本领须要去支持前台交易场景和交易功效的实行。

即这种数据效劳本领须要具备必定的数据及时性乞求,那么咱们大概瞅到闭于于交易中台自己也会供给数据效劳本领,比方订单核心也供给订单查问数据效劳本领,那么二者的辨别毕竟在何处?

发端领会包括:

  1. 交易中台数据效劳及时性最强,数据中台数据效劳准及时
  2. 交易中台数据效劳简单数据闭于象,而数据中台数据效劳不妨供给通联后普遍据闭于象会合后数据
  3. 交易中台数据效劳包括了CRUD各品种型,然而是数据中台的数据效劳普遍为简单的查问效劳

02

这点领会领会后,咱们再回顾便容易搞领会何以数据中台须要供给准及时的数据效劳API接口——

要瞅到在微效劳架构下建立的交易中台各个核心,依照尺度的微效劳架构乞求,各个核心闭于应的数据库自己也实脚是独力和拆分的,订单核心是订单数据库,用户核心是用户数据库,彼此之间实脚笔直独力以方便运用的精致扩充。

然而是这种数据库拆分戴来最大的问题即是——当交易场景须要基层多个交易数据闭于象供给通联后会合后的查问数据集的时间极不方便。

为了处理这个问题,本质上咱们有二种干法来进行处置:

第一种:建立一个范围效劳层组件

即咱们径自建立一个范围效劳层组件大概微效劳模块,来供给安排后的范围效劳本领,这个组件假如须要供给一个通联多个交易闭于象的数据集中,那么便须要调用过个API接口返回多个独力数据集中,而后在组件交易逻辑实行中来完成多个数据集的安排处事。

虽然闭于于查问类效劳不分别式工作问题,然而是这种办法在本能上确定存留较大耗费,上风则在这种办法不必前台考察屡次API接口效劳,共时又保护了数据的及时性。

第二种:建立数据中台,而后供给盛开数据效劳本领接口

这种办法即是建立数据中台,在数据中台完成交易中台多个数据库数据的数据采集和安排,产生一个完备的超过的数据模型,因为有了完备的数据,因此很天然不妨供给通联会合数据闭于象效劳的本领。

然而是这种办法的问题也比较明显,即是何如样保护数据自己的及时性和普遍性,实脚的实常常常很难保护,那么何如样保护数据的准及时性,何如样保护数据采集过程中展示问题而引导数据不普遍也须要计划。

把所有想领会了,也即是想领会了数据中台的一个闭头效率,即是供给准及时的会合数据效劳本领API接口并进行盛开给前台运用,方便前台交易场景和功效的实行,而不是大概的供给一个供分处理策的数据库。因此闭于于数据中台的这个闭头本领咱们不妨大概的领会为:

分别式ODS库+本领盛开平台+准及时数据本领供给

这个即是咱们前方谈到的数据中台的一个闭头本领供给,那么咱们谈到数据采集集成本领,分别式数据保存,及时数据集成,数据流处置,包括好像Hadoop大数据平台等,十脚这些都是数据中台在实行过程中为了满脚分别式+及时性的本领支持。

先领会领会何以必要数据中台,再来搞领会数据中台建立须要用到什么本领,什么平台,所有闭于中台战术,中台建立的思考逻辑才会领会。

 

本文由 @人月传奇 受权发布于大众都是产品经理,未经作家答应,遏止转载

题图来自Unsplash,基于CC0协议